In this publication, we show the link between environmental change, based on Inuit perspectives and\ndirect observations, and biodiversity, which is the sum of all living beings and things. We summarize the\nmany changes Inuit have reported as impacting biodiversity, such as the appearance of insects formerly\nnot seen, and at the same time examine how local knowledge is crucial to adapting to changes in biodiversity.\nFinally, we discuss the connection between biodiversity and Inuit health and why changes in\nArctic biodiversity will mean changes to human life in the Arctic.\nInuit have been reporting environmental changes in the Arctic, such as differences in sea-ice thaw and\nfreeze-up, for years and several publications have documented these observations from various regions\nof the circumpolar world. The most comprehensive approach to document these observations in Canada\nis found in the book Unikkaaqatigiit — Putting the Human Face on Climate Change: Perspectives from Inuit\nin Canada (Nickels et al., 2006). Unikkaaqatigiit summarizes what Inuit have said about environmental\nchange. It is also one of the first published records of Inuit adaptations to climate change in that it\nreports on how communities and individuals are responding to change and adjusting to it in their daily\nlives.\nThe main findings in our report rely upon published materials on biodiversity. The core of this report is\nbased on materials produced under international and national biodiversity programs and documentation\nof Indigenous insights into climate change. The tables provide hands-on examples of how local\nobservations can be organized to have relevance in discussions of biodiversity.\nChanges in climate and weather events in the Arctic and their subsequent effects on the biological systems\nof the region have impacts on food security and economic well-being of Inuit. Limited access to\ncaribou, seal, fish, berries and other ‘country foods’ leads to greater reliance on imported store-bought\nfoods. Aside from a change in diet, which can be stressful for the human body, the transition from nutrient-\ndense country foods to less nutritious store-bought foods may have an even more significant impact\non the health of Inuit, in the short and long term.\nThe link between the loss of biological diversity and the parallel loss of cultural diversity is only now\nbeginning to be recognized. The Arctic is homeland to Inuit, not only in Canada but circumpolar, and\nInuit are the first to see and feel the changes in ice, water and land. The pace of change has quickened\nand we can observe changes in temperature, plant growth and wildlife behavior within several calendar\nyears instead of over centuries. Changes to the living resources of the Arctic translate into rapid changes\nin the lifestyles of local human populations and increased stress on the health and well-being of Inuit.\nWe hope that this publication and others like it will draw attention to the importance of biodiversity\nin the circumpolar Arctic and that the world will be guided by the knowledge and wisdom of Inuit\nregarding the homelands, environment and biodiversity upon which they rely.
